How does digital signage solve these challenges?

  • The digital signages in airports and stations can update the latest maps and traffic information in the stations in real-time, and give people the best route suggestions.

  • The digital signage is controlled remotely through cloud services to ensure the accuracy and timeliness of the information, and it is also easy to maintain.

  • By matching smart sensors, AI cameras, and AI algorithm software, digital signage can perform a certain degree of statistics and analysis on the traffic flow in the area, including age, gender, and the number of people, to achieve precise advertising and marketing.

  • The passenger density of each car is measured by the sensors in the car, and then the information is displayed on the digital sign. Passengers waiting outside the car can see this information in time so that passengers have more time to find a more comfortable, more efficient pick-up location.

  • The Washington subway system uses digital signage to inform passengers of current and future service changes, helping passengers to better plan their journeys and improve travel efficiency.
    Vancouver’s transportation link network uses digital signage to provide news, weather, and other interesting content to waiting passengers.

  • In public transportation places, there are a large number of peripheral services such as catering and entertainment. Digital signage can not only display route information but also display these products and services in more detail and comprehensively to attract consumer consumption.
